编程中最难的是什么意思
-
编程中最难的是理解和解决复杂的问题。编程是一门需要逻辑思维和创造力的艺术,它涉及到解决各种各样的问题和挑战。在编程过程中,遇到难题是常有的事情,但是最难的是那些复杂的问题,它们需要深入的理解和创造性的解决方案。
首先,复杂的问题通常涉及多个变量和条件,需要编程者有较强的逻辑思维和分析能力。解决这类问题需要对问题进行全面的分析,了解问题的背景和要求,确定问题的关键点和主要挑战。
其次,解决复杂问题还需要编程者有良好的算法和数据结构的知识。算法是解决问题的步骤和方法,而数据结构是存储和组织数据的方式。对于复杂的问题,选择合适的算法和数据结构是至关重要的,它们可以提高程序的效率和性能。
此外,解决复杂问题还需要编程者具备良好的调试和排错能力。在编程过程中,难免会出现错误和bug,尤其是在处理复杂问题时。对于这些问题,编程者需要有耐心和细心,通过调试和排错的方式找出问题所在,并进行修复。
最后,解决复杂问题还需要编程者具备团队合作和沟通能力。复杂问题往往需要多人合作来解决,每个人负责不同的部分。在这个过程中,编程者需要与团队成员进行有效的沟通和协作,确保问题能够得到有效的解决。
综上所述,编程中最难的是理解和解决复杂的问题。要解决这些问题,编程者需要有逻辑思维、算法和数据结构知识、调试和排错能力,以及团队合作和沟通能力。只有不断学习和提升自己的技能,才能在编程中更好地应对复杂问题。
1年前 -
编程中最难的是什么意思是指在编程过程中最具挑战性和困难的方面或问题是什么。以下是编程中最难的几个方面:
-
理解和掌握算法和数据结构:算法和数据结构是编程的基础,但它们往往是最困难的部分。理解和应用复杂的算法和数据结构需要深入的数学和计算机科学知识,以及抽象思维能力。
-
解决复杂的逻辑问题:编程涉及解决各种逻辑问题,包括设计和实现复杂的程序逻辑、处理边界情况和异常情况等。这需要开发者具备深入的问题分析和解决能力。
-
调试和排错:编程中难免会出现各种错误和 bug,而调试和排错是解决问题的关键。但在大型项目中,问题可能非常复杂且难以追踪,需要具备良好的调试技巧和耐心。
-
理解和应用新技术和框架:编程领域不断发展和演进,新的技术和框架层出不穷。理解和应用新技术和框架需要学习和掌握新的概念和工具,对于初学者和有限的时间和资源来说可能是一项挑战。
-
与团队合作和沟通:在大型项目中,编程往往需要与其他开发者、设计师、测试人员等进行合作。与团队合作需要良好的沟通和协作能力,以确保项目的顺利进行和高质量的交付。
总之,编程中最难的是理解和掌握算法和数据结构、解决复杂的逻辑问题、调试和排错、理解和应用新技术和框架,以及与团队合作和沟通。克服这些挑战需要不断学习、实践和积累经验。
1年前 -
-
编程中最难的是什么意思?这个问题的答案可能因人而异,因为每个人在编程过程中会遇到不同的困难。然而,总体来说,以下是一些编程中常见的难点:
-
理解和掌握编程语言:学习一门新的编程语言需要花费时间和精力。理解语法、关键字和编程范式可能是初学者最困难的部分。
-
解决问题:编程是解决问题的过程。面对一个问题,需要将其分解成更小的子问题,并找到解决方案。这需要逻辑思维和问题解决能力。
-
调试和修复错误:调试是编程过程中不可避免的一部分。找到程序中的错误并修复它们可能需要花费大量的时间和精力。
-
管理复杂性:随着项目规模的增长,代码的复杂性也会增加。管理大型代码库、模块化设计和维护代码的可读性是一个挑战。
-
理解算法和数据结构:算法和数据结构是编程的核心。理解和实现复杂的算法和数据结构可能是一项艰巨的任务。
-
处理并发和并行性:编写能够处理并发和并行性的程序是一项复杂的任务。理解线程、进程、锁和同步机制可能需要花费一些时间。
-
学习和适应新技术:编程是一个不断发展和变化的领域。学习新技术和适应新的编程框架可能需要不断地投入时间和精力。
总的来说,编程中最难的部分可能因个人经验和技能而异。对于一个人来说容易的问题对另一个人来说可能很难。然而,通过不断的学习和实践,克服这些难点是可能的。
1年前 -